Supali Village Details

Supali is a Village in Nuapada Tehsil , Nuapada district and Odisha State. Supali village Pin code is 766105. Supali Village Total population is 499 and number of houses are 131. Female Population is 53.5%. Village literacy rate is 38.3% and the Female Literacy rate is 16.8%.

Location and Administration

Supali Village Gram Panchayath name is Chulabhat. Supali is 24 km distance from Sub District HeadQuarter Nuapada and it is 24 km distance from District HeadQuarter Nuapada. Nearest Statutory Town is Khariar Road in 18 km Distance . Supali Forest area is 19.33 hectares, Non-Agricultural area is 35.52 hectares andTotal Water fall area is 0 hectares

Agriculture

Paddy, Pulses and Mung are agriculture commodities grow in this village. 15 hours agricultural power supply in summer and 16 hours agricultural power supply in winter is available in this village.

Drinking-Water and Sanitation

Treated Tap Water Supply all round the year and in summer also available. Untreated Tap Water Supply all round the year and in summer available. UnCovered Well, Hand Pump and Tube Wells/Boreholes are other Drinking Water sources.
No Drainage System Available in this Village. This Village Covered Under Total Sanitation. There is no system to Collect garbage on street. Drain water is discharged into sewer plant.

Transportation

There is no Public Bus service in less than 10 km. There is no Railway Station in less than 10 km. Man pulled Cycle Rickshaws Available in this Village. Animal Driven Carts are there in this Village.

No Nearest National Highway in less than 10 km. No Nearest State Highway in less than 10 km. District Road passes through this village.
Pucca road, Kuccha Road and Foot Path are other Roads and Transportation within the village.
